A public defender is a lawyer appointed by the government to represent individuals who cannot afford to hire private legal counsel in criminal cases. This role is crucial in ensuring that the right to legal representation is upheld, especially for defendants facing serious charges where the potential penalties include imprisonment. Public defenders play a significant role in safeguarding the due process rights of defendants and are deeply involved in the legal process from pre-trial through appeals.
